Publication Accuracy of Glucose Meter Among Adults in a Semi-urban Area in Kathmandu, Nepal(Nepal Medical Association, 2019) Pokhrel, Asmita; Silvanus, Vinutha; Pokhrel, Buddhi Raj; Baral, Binaya; Khanal, Madhav; Gyawali, Prajwal; Pokhrel, Laxman; Regmi, DeepakAbstract Introduction: Glucose meters are gaining popularity in monitoring of blood glucose at household levels and in health care set-ups due to their portability, affordability and convenience of use over the laboratory based reference methods. Still they are not free of limitations. Operator’s technique, extreme temperatures, humidity, patients’ medication, hematocrit values can affect the reliability of glucose meter results. Hence, the accuracy of glucose meter has been the topic of concern since years. Therefore, present study aims to evaluate the analytical and clinical accuracy of glucose meter using International Organization for Standardization 15197 guideline. Methods: A community based descriptive cross-sectional study was conducted in Kapan, Kathmandu, Nepal in April 2018. Glucose levels were measured using glucose meter and reference laboratory method simultaneously among 203 adults ≥20 years, after an overnight fasting and two hours of ingestion of 75 grams glucose. Modified Bland-Altman plots were created by incorporating ISO 15197 guidelines to check the analytical accuracy and Park error grid was used to evaluate the clinical accuracy of the device. Results: Modified Bland-Altman plots showed>95% of the test results were beyond the acceptable analytical criteria of ISO 15197:2003 and 2013. Park Error Grid-Analysis showed 99% of the data within zones A and B of the consensus error grid. Conclusions: Glucose meter readings were within clinically acceptable parameters despite discrepancies on analytical merit. Possible sources of interferences must be avoided during the measurement to minimize the disparities and the values should be interpreted with caution. Keywords: accuracy; analytical; Bland -Altman; clinical; glucose meter; Park error grid.Publication Hypothyroidism among Patients Visiting the Department of Biochemistry in Central Laboratory of a Tertiary Care Center: A Descriptive Cross-Sectional Study(Nepal Medical Association, 2023) Pokhrel, Buddhi Raj; Chandra Jha, Amit; Ghimire, Rachita; Shrestha, Jharana; Tamang, Binaya; Gautam, Narayan; Yadav, Tapeshwar; Gharti, Sakar BabuAbstract Introduction: The global burden of thyroid disorders, especially hypothyroidism, is high and increasing. Prevalence studies of such disorders are limited in Nepal. The aim of this study was to find out the prevalence of hypothyroidism among patients visiting the Department of Biochemistry in the central laboratory of a tertiary care centre. Methods: A descriptive cross-sectional study was conducted among patients visiting the Department of Biochemistry in the central laboratory from 1 August 2020 to 31 July 2021 after taking ethical approval from the Institutional Review Committee (Reference number: UCMS/IRC/054/20). Patients of all age groups and gender were considered. Hypothyroid patients were identified based on the thyroid function parameters. They were further categorized as sub-clinical and overt hypothyroid. A convenience sampling method was used. Point estimate and 95% Confidence Interval were calculated. Results: Among 3,010 patients, the prevalence of hypothyroidism was seen in 770 (25.58%) (24.02-27.14, 95% Confidence Interval). Out of total hypothyroid patients, 555 (72.08%) were females. Overt hypothyroidism 519 (67.40%) was the most prevalent hypothyroid disorder, followed by subclinical hypothyroidism 251 (32.60%). Conclusions: The prevalence of hypothyroidism among patients visiting the Department of Biochemistry in the central laboratory of a tertiary care centre was higher than in other studies done in similar settings.Publication Hypovitaminosis D among Blood Samples of Patients Presenting to the Department of Biochemistry of a Tertiary Care Center(Nepal Medical Association, 2023) Tamang, Binaya; Pokhrel, Buddhi Raj; Shrestha, Jharana; Gautam, Narayan; Sharma, Binit KumarAbstract Introduction: Hypovitaminosis D is a global public health problem affecting approximately one billion people, with a particularly high prevalence in South Asia. Several hospital-based studies from Nepal show a high prevalence of hypovitaminosis D. However, large-scale community-based studies are lacking. The aim of the study was to find out the prevalence of hypovitaminosis D among blood samples of patients presenting to the Department of Biochemistry of a tertiary care centre. Methods: A descriptive cross-sectional study was conducted among blood samples of patients presenting to the Department of Biochemistry of a tertiary care centre from 3 November 2022 to 30 April 2023 after obtaining ethical approval from the Institutional Review Committee (Reference number: 136/22). Patients of all age groups and genders who were sent for the evaluation of Vitamin D at the laboratory were included. A convenience sampling technique was used. The point estimate was calculated at a 95% Confidence Interval. Results: Out of 376 patients, hypovitaminosis was seen in 274 (72.87%) (68.38-77.36, 95% Confidence Interval). Vitamin D insufficiency was present in 252 (91.97%) and vitamin D deficiency was present in 22 (8.03%) participants. Conclusions: The prevalence of hypovitaminosis D was found to be higher than other studies done in similar settings.
